A Vintage Christmas unfolds in the quaint town of Oak Creek, where the charm is palpable. Tessa, a historian, embodies the passion for nostalgia, fighting to keep the town's history alive, especially the old Post Office. The arrival of Noah, a slick developer, brings tension and sparks, a classic clash of old versus new. It's a gentle exploration of community and heritage, woven through moments that balance comedy and drama quite nicely. The performances are sincere, capturing the essence of small-town life, and the atmosphere is rich with festive imagery and practical effects that evoke a warm, vintage Christmas feel. The pacing allows for a slow burn, giving the audience time to connect with Tessa's plight and Noah's transformation.
